Can a judge uphold a parking ticket that you plead not guilty to without the officer that issued the ticket testifying against you. Do you have the right to face your accuser in these matters. I'm in West Virginia.

You have the right to face your accuser only for felonies and gross misdemeanors. This would happen only if you were arrested. Parking tickets in most places are considered civil penalties and do not go against your driving or arrest record. All that was required at your hearing was someone representing the party that issued the ticket, usually someone fresh out of law school working for the DA's office. Unless your someone that gets parking tickets on a regular basis and may face more serious charges because of it, just pay the ticket and park legally next time.
